Located in St. Augustine, FL, Sonny's BBQ is a gem for all barbecue lovers. This New American - Barbeque spot offers a range of amenities such as delivery, takeout, reservations, and even catering services. The casual setting with moderate noise levels makes it a perfect spot for groups, kids, or a laid-back lunch or dinner.

Sonny's BBQ has garnered praise from patrons like Sarah L., Kevin B., and Jessie G. who have raved about the flavorful dishes and exceptional service. The Sweet Carolina sandwich, corn nuggets, ribs, chicken, pulled pork, and brisket sampler have all received high accolades for their taste and quality.

Not to be missed is the friendly and interactive staff, particularly manager Fred, who goes above and beyond to ensure a pleasant dining experience. The cozy wood shack ambiance adds to the charm of Sonny's BBQ, making it a must-visit for those craving delicious barbecue fare.

With a diverse menu and attentive service, Sonny's BBQ promises a satisfying dining experience that will leave you coming back for more. Next time you visit, don't miss out on the unlimited ribs special for $15.99 and experience the true essence of Southern barbecue done right.

I drove over to Sonny's to meet a fellow partner for lunch today. Going inside, the interior had a cozy wood shack feel to it. For lunch, I ordered the Sweet Carolina sandwich - pulled pork with coleslaw on a bun or texas toast. Moving on with my review, the food overall was great! The texas toast added a great crunch and buttery taste to contrast with the creamy coleslaw and tender saucy shreds of pork! I felt the mac n cheese was good (didn't resemble kraft lol), but could use maybe some sort of pizazz. As for service, our server was extremely attentive throughout our meal! Overall, this was my first, and won't be my last time visiting Sonny's as it was a good experience! The final rating, for now, is 4/5. Next time I'd probably do the unlimited ribs for $15.99!

My wife and I stopped in for lunch. We were promptly seated and our server was very nice. Orders were taken and food arrived in a reasonable time. I had the sliced brisket sandwich on garlic toast. As the menu stated, the "sliced" is lean but if you order the "chopped" it is mixed. Brisket was tasty and moist with almost no fat, just as advertised. Garlic toast was fresh, hot, and garlicky. Had a side of cole slaw that was very good. My wife had the pulled chicken sandwich on a bun, which she enjoyed. Absolutely no complaints. Food was good, hot and service was great. We also didn't walk in with fine dining expectations. For what it is, I feel 5 stars is deserved.
